However, we like Australian firefighters off duty as well. These shirtless heroes are featured in The Firefighters Calendar 2022, and they're not the only ones on it.
Country's Wildlife is included in this calendar and we all love the adorable animals that are sharing the spotlight with the firefighters. There are horses, cats, dogs, koalas, donkeys, and more.
Matt Haydon has taken a spot as the cover of this list as he's one of the fittest firefighters here. Others won't disappoint you either.
As the firefighters have an extensive history of helping with various causes, they thought of a good idea to team up with Greater Good Charities (US-Based Organization). Their goal was to take their good hands internationally as well.
The organization's main goal is to renovate the shelters of animals and homeless people. To take care of abandoned animals and the people that care for them.

Taking the calendar to the United States is just something that Australians don't mind doing. They remember the support from Americans when there were bushfires going around quite recently.
We can all respect that.
The people that were behind this very project had their say. "The money that was raised by our US fans went to support native Australian animals that were severely injured. One of the incredible local-based charities supported by the calendar donation was the Byron Bay Wildlife Hospital."
